What are the club dues for the 2023-2024 school year?
$100
When does it have to be paid?
The fees may be paid up front but can also be paid by semester. The minimum fee of $50 must be paid
before uniform distribution. The remainder may be paid half in the fall and spring semesters. There are many ways to pay the club fee, either directly, or by participating in fundraising. Please see "How can the dues be paid" below for more details.

How is this different from the dues we paid during enrollment?
Most years, a $50 district fee is required to enroll in any co-curricular class on campus. These funds go directly to
the school district, and do not come back to the choir program. There is a school fee of $30. This only
covers the copyright fees paid for the music that is performed. All other expenses (uniforms, banquet ticket, t-shirt, tech equipment, transportation, etc.) are paid by the club fee. However, because of COVID we do not even have these district/school fees.

What is my student's Individual Account?
Each student has their own account within the Booster Club account that is maintained and tracked for
payment of club fees by the Club Treasurer. Once a student’s club fee has been paid, any additional
contribution of funds for that individual student will be added to their Individual Account as a credit.
The credit amount in an Individual Account can be used towards guest tickets for the year-end
banquet, lost item charges, costs for specialized field trips and programs, etc. Example: During years
when a choir travels to a festival and a Disney visit is included, Booster funds are NOT used for
students’ hotel stays, Disney tickets, etc., however funds in an Individual Account may be used.

What are the dues used for?
The dues are used to pay for out-of-pocket expenses incurred during the year such as: uniforms, dry-
cleaning, repair, and replacement of uniforms, water and snacks during concerts and other
performances, transportation such as busing to festivals, microphones and other sound equipment,
piano tuning, concert musicians, concert programs, concert security, concert piano accompanist,
festival registration, and the year-end banquet and awards for all students.
